Win32_TSDeploymentSettings 类

定义 RemoteApp 管理器在创建远程桌面协议时使用的默认设置, (RDP) 文件。 这些设置不会影响任何已发布的应用程序或桌面。

语法

class Win32_TSDeploymentSettings : CIM_LogicalElement
{
  string   Caption;
  string   Description;
  datetime InstallDate;
  string   Name;
  string   Status;
  sint32   Port;
  string   FarmName;
  sint32   GatewayUsage;
  string   GatewayName;
  sint32   GatewayAuthMode;
  boolean  GatewayUseCachedCreds;
  boolean  RequireServerAuth;
  sint32   ColorBitDepth;
  boolean  AllowFontSmoothing;
  boolean  UseMultimon;
  sint32   RedirectionOptions;
  boolean  HasCertificate;
  uint8    CertificateHash[];
  string   CertificateIssuedTo;
  string   CertificateIssuedBy;
  string   CertificateExpiresOn;
  string   CustomRDPSettings;
  string   DeploymentRDPSettings;
};

成员

Win32_TSDeploymentSettings 类具有以下类型的成员:

属性

Win32_TSDeploymentSettings 类具有这些属性。

AllowFontSmoothing

数据类型: 布尔值

访问类型:读/写

指示是否允许字体平滑。

Caption

数据类型: 字符串

访问类型:只读

限定符: MaxLen (64)

简短说明 (对象的单行字符串) 。

此属性继承自 CIM_ManagedSystemElement

CertificateExpiresOn

数据类型: 字符串

访问类型:读/写

证书过期的日期。 此值存储为 64 位 FILETIME 格式。

CertificateHash

数据类型: uint8 数组

访问类型:读/写

用于对 RDP 文件进行签名的证书的指纹。

CertificateIssuedBy

数据类型: 字符串

访问类型:读/写

指定证书的颁发者。

CertificateIssuedTo

数据类型: 字符串

访问类型:读/写

指定证书颁发给谁。

ColorBitDepth

数据类型: sint32

访问类型:读/写

显示器的颜色位深度。 可能的值为 4、8、15、16、24 和 32。

CustomRDPSettings

数据类型: 字符串

访问类型:读/写

与 RemoteApp Manager 中的自定义 RDP 设置相对应的 RDP 文件的内容。

DeploymentRDPSettings

数据类型: 字符串

访问类型:读/写

与 RemoteApp Manager 中的部署设置对应的 RDP 文件的内容。 如果设置了此值,RDP 部署设置将取代此类中的默认设置。 例如,如果在此类中设置 GatewayAuthMode 属性,并设置 DeploymentRDPSettings 属性,则将忽略此类中的 GatewayAuthMode 属性,并使用 DeploymentRDPSettings 中的GatewayAuthMode 值。

描述

数据类型: 字符串

访问类型:只读

对象的说明。

此属性继承自 CIM_ManagedSystemElement

FarmName

数据类型: 字符串

访问类型:读/写

RD 会话主机服务器的名称,或 RD 会话主机服务器场的 FQDN) (完全限定的域名。

GatewayAuthMode

数据类型: sint32

访问类型:读/写

RD 网关身份验证方法。 可以使用以下值。

0

密码

1

智能卡

4

允许用户在连接期间选择。

GatewayName

数据类型: 字符串

访问类型:读/写

要使用的 RD 网关服务器的名称。

GatewayUsage

数据类型: sint32

访问类型:读/写

指示是否使用 RD 网关服务器通过防火墙连接到目标 RD 会话主机服务器。 可以使用以下值。

0

请勿使用 RD 网关服务器。

1

使用 RD 网关服务器。 绕过本地地址的 RD 网关服务器。

2

使用 RD 网关服务器。

3

自动检测 RD 网关服务器设置。

GatewayUseCachedCreds

数据类型: 布尔值

访问类型:读/写

如果可能,请对 RD 网关服务器和 RD 会话主机服务器使用相同的用户凭据。

HasCertificate

数据类型: 布尔值

访问类型:读/写

指示是否使用证书对 RDP 文件进行签名。

InstallDate

数据类型: datetime

访问类型:只读

限定符: 映射字符串 (“MIF”。DMTF |ComponentID|001.5“)

对象的安装日期。 缺少值并不表示未安装 对象。

此属性继承自 CIM_ManagedSystemElement

名称

数据类型: 字符串

访问类型:只读

对象的名称。

此属性继承自 CIM_ManagedSystemElement

端口

数据类型: sint32

访问类型:读/写

要使用的 RDP 端口。

重定向选项

数据类型: sint32

访问类型:读/写

指定 RemoteApp 连接的设备和资源重定向选项。 可以组合 重定向选项的 标志。 可以使用以下值。

0

无设备或资源重定向。

1

重定向磁盘驱动器。

2

重定向打印机。

4

重定向剪贴板。

8

重定向受支持的即插即用设备。

16

重定向智能卡。

32

重定向音频。

64

重定向串行端口。

RequireServerAuth

数据类型: 布尔值

访问类型:读/写

指示是否要求服务器身份验证。

Status

数据类型: 字符串

访问类型:只读

限定符: MaxLen (10)

对象的当前状态。 可以定义各种操作和非操作状态。 操作状态包括:“正常”、“降级”和“预失败”, (元素(例如已启用 SMART 的硬盘驱动器)可能正常运行,但预测近期) 故障。 非操作状态包括:“错误”、“正在启动”、“正在停止”和“服务”。 后者“服务”可以在磁盘镜像重新同步、重新加载用户权限列表或其他管理工作期间应用。 并非所有此类工作都是在线的,但托管元素既不是“正常”,也不是处于其他状态之一。

此属性继承自 CIM_ManagedSystemElement

(“确定”)

(“错误”)

(“已降级”)

(“未知”)

(“Pred Fail”)

(“启动”)

(“停止”)

(“Service”)

UseMultimon

数据类型: 布尔值

访问类型:读/写

指示是否为桌面启用了多个监视器。

备注

你必须是管理员组的成员才能使用此类设置属性。

如果 RequireServerAuth 设置为 TRUE,请考虑以下事项:

  • 如果 RemoteApp 程序用于 Intranet,并且所有客户端计算机都运行 Windows Server 2008 或 Windows Vista,则无需将 RD 会话主机服务器配置为使用 SSL 证书。 在这种情况下,应使用网络级身份验证。
  • 必须为 FarmName 属性的值指定服务器或场的 FQDN。

若要连接到“CIMV2\TerminalServices”命名空间,身份验证级别必须包含数据包隐私。 对于 C/C++ 调用,这是 RPC_C_AUTHN_LEVEL_PKT_PRIVACY的身份验证级别,可以使用 CoSetProxyBlanket COM 函数进行设置。 对于 Visual Basic 和脚本调用,这是 WbemAuthenticationLevelPktPrivacy 或“pktPrivacy”的身份验证级别,值为 6。 以下 Visual Basic Scripting Edition (VBScript) 示例演示如何使用数据包隐私连接到远程计算机。

strComputer = "RemoteServer1" 
Set objServices = GetObject( _
    "winmgmts:{authenticationLevel=pktPrivacy}!Root/CIMv2/TerminalServices")

托管对象格式 (MOF) 文件包含 Windows Management Instrumentation (WMI) 类的定义。 添加关联角色时,它们将安装在计算机上。 有关 MOF 文件的详细信息,请参阅 托管对象格式 (MOF)

要求

要求
最低受支持的客户端
无受支持的版本
最低受支持的服务器
Windows Server 2008
命名空间
Root\CIMv2\TerminalServices
MOF
Tsallow.mof
DLL
TsPubWmi.dll